Title
Catfirth
Date Of Photo
mid 1930's
Description
Catfirth; from behind the Lower Quoys, looking south with steam and motor drifters at anchor. The four steam drifters are LK 1 FELICIA; LK 87 TEA ROSE; LK 56 RETRIEVE; LK 682 MAID OF THULE. Near the shore is the wreck of steam drifter LK 385 ROVA HEAD.
